Summary

The purpose of this study is to assess the efficiency of permanent biventricular pacing using three ventricular leads in terms of reduction in adverse cardiac events rates, improvement in cardiac capacity and patients' functional status in subjects with congestive heart failure and a physiologic (sinus) rhythm.

Interventions

DEVICE

Cardiac resynchronization pacemaker (InSync Sentry or Concerto, Medtronic, Minneapolis, MN,USA) with two intracardiac leads

Cardiac resynchronization with two intraventricular leads: one in the right ventricle and one in the left ventricle (via the coronary sinus)

DEVICE

Triple-site cardiac resynchronization

Cardiac resynchronization pacemaker (InSync Sentry or Concerto, Medtronic, Minneapolis, MN,USA) with three intraventricular leads: one in the right ventricle and two in the left ventricle (via the coronary sinus). Two left ventricular leads connected with Y-connector (Lead Adaptor 2827, Medtronic, Minneapolis, MN, USA)
